Output 6864daa9f33a06b6f973b1e31f5cdcd8c7de0cf0036a006edeb1bcd5b6ae923b:0

value
661568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0310fdc50cd18b398d5d71efffc911532c0c3b00 OP_EQUAL
address
31yEJhEzftfYLpwgYdvNiYRRb24YGH2Q5r
transaction
6864daa9f33a06b6f973b1e31f5cdcd8c7de0cf0036a006edeb1bcd5b6ae923b
confirmations
373949
spent
true